First, you need to understand the characters well. Know their personalities, backstories, and how they interact in the original series. For example, Beast Boy is often light - hearted while Raven is more reserved. Second, create an engaging plot. It could be a new adventure they go on together or a situation that forces them to confront their feelings. And don't forget to add some conflict to keep the story interesting.
Develop their relationship gradually. Don't rush into making them a couple right away. Show their small interactions, like how Beast Boy tries to make Raven laugh or Raven shows concern for Beast Boy when he's in danger. These little details will make the fanfiction more engaging.
When writing a fanfiction about Raven, Beast Boy and Terra, it's important to create a vivid setting. Whether it's the city they protect or a new, unknown world they end up in. Develop the plot gradually, building up the tension. You can also introduce new characters that interact with them in interesting ways. And always keep in mind the emotional arcs of the main characters. Raven might be dealing with her inner demons, Beast Boy with his self - identity, and Terra with her past mistakes. By addressing these in the story, you can create a more complex and satisfying fanfiction.

First, you need to understand their characters well. Raven is complex, with her powers and her inner turmoil. Beast Boy is more carefree but also has his own insecurities. Start with a situation that brings them together, like a common enemy. Then, build their relationship gradually. Let them have small moments of connection, like a shared look or a kind word.
